The countdown is on to our first Christmas and it’s certainly going to be one to remember, with Father Christmas, reindeer, festive performances and Stratford-upon-Avon’s tallest real Christmas tree all set to delight our visitors.

On Thursday 23rd November, following on from Stratford’s annual Christmas light switch-on at the Town Hall, we’ll be inviting visitors to a fun-filled festive evening between 4.45pm and 6.30pm.

Creating a bit of Christmas sparkle, our beautiful 25ft Nordman Fir tree, will be lit up with 2,500 fairy-lights,  helping to mark the beginning of Christmas at Bell Court

Adding to the magic, you’ll be invited to meet Father Christmas’ reindeer and post a letter to the man himself (all of which will be replied to). There will also be a brass band playing Christmas carols, as well as performances from Rosie T Dance Academy and the pantomime cast of Jack and the Beanstalk from Stratford Art House.

Additionally, Everyman Cinema will be hosting a festive screening of popular Christmas classic, Elf, at 6pm, for the bargain price of £6. They’ll also be giving out free hot chocolate to people visiting Bell Court too!

As if all that wasn’t enough, new luxury home accessories boutique, Farringdon and Forbes will be staying open until 8pm and will be offering a 15% discount on all Christmas decorations purchased on the night; perfect for Christmas shoppers.
